selenium2

PDF格納先の判別

生成されたPDFファイルの保存先(IE限定) IEではPDFは生成されるとデフォルトでは一時的にTemporary Internet Filesに格納されますが、 その配下は隠しファイル・システムファイルとなっていて設定を変えないと なかなかみることができないという現状がありま…

java.awt.Robotによるモダン(?)な画面キャプチャ

画面キャプチャの基本 テストケースを打鍵しながら画面をキャプチャするのは TakesScreenshot#getScreenshotAs(OutputType.FILE)で取れるのは いろいろ調べて理解しました。 How do you capture "Popup Alert Window" ですが、アラートのポップアップが出て…

InternetExplorerの一時フォルダから出力されたPDFを取得する

IEでテストケース打鍵しつつ画面キャプチャをとるのは容易ですが、 テストケース内で出力されたPDFなどを一時フォルダから 取得できないかといろいろもがいた結果がこれです。 環境 jdk:javaSE-1.7 selenium-ie-driver:2.32.0 commons-io:2.4 ソースコー…

EclipseでSeleniumServer起動

触り始めて色々気になったロジックとかがあって、 Eclipse上からSeleniumって動かせないのかなと試行錯誤して ようやくできるようになったのでメモしておきます。これでブレークポイントを付けてseleniumServer本体の デバッグなどができるようになります。(…

result(結果)ファイルの文字化け対策

実行環境 ・Windows7 ・J2SE7 ・FireFox20 ・selenium-server-standalone-2.32.0 結果ファイルに文字化けが起こる(T-T) seleniumで以下のようなYahooにアクセスする 簡単な簡単なテストケースを作って、 コマンドプロンプトで以下のコマンドで流す。java -ja…